Secondary English Teacher

Position: Secondary English Teacher
Location: Twickenham
Employment Type: Full-Time
Salary: £150 a day
Start Date:ASAP

Are you passionate about inspiring the next generation of learners? Do you have a love for English literature and language and the skills to engage students in critical thinking, creativity, and communication? If so, we want you to join our dynamic team!

About Us:

A wonderful school in Twickehnam!

The Role:

As a Secondary English Teacher, you will:

  • Deliver high-quality lessons that inspire and challenge students.
  • Teach across Key Stage 3, Key Stage 4, and potentially Key Stage 5 (A-Level), depending on experience.
  • Foster a love of reading, writing, and critical analysis.
  • Create a positive and inclusive learning environment where every student feels valued.
  • Support and assess student progress, providing constructive feedback.
  • Collaborate with colleagues to develop engaging curricula and innovative teaching practices.
About You:

We are seeking a passionate educator who:

  • Holds a degree in English or a related field and a teaching qualification (PGCE/QTS or equivalent).
  • Has experience teaching English at the secondary level, with a proven track record of student success.
  • Possesses excellent communication and classroom management skills.
  • Is enthusiastic, creative, and committed to continuous professional development.
  • Demonstrates a commitment to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of young people.
